Bloggers, come and meet Mr Shariibuu

Malaysian NGOs will meet Altantuya’s father, Mr. Stev Shariibuu at the Selangor Chinese Assembly Hall (No. 1, Jalan Maharajalela today (Friday) @ 10.30am. The event is coordinated by SUARAM, and will see more than 20 NGOs coming together to show their support for the Mongolian Pyschology professor, who lost his eldest daughter, a professional interpreter, when she was killed so gruesomely through C4 explosives,  late last year. 

Bloggers are most welcome to cover the event and to meet the man whose life has turned so tragically upside down. He needs to know there are many many Malaysians who are kind and compassionate.
